1. e-Zero FIR Goes National: PRAGATI 52 Orders All-State Rollout After Digital Arrest Scams

The 52nd PRAGATI (Pro-Active Governance and Timely Implementation) meeting, chaired by the Prime Minister on June 24, delivered the most consequential cybersecurity-governance directive of 2026: all state governments must immediately implement the e-Zero FIR system developed by the Indian Cybercrime Coordination Centre (I4C).

The system automatically converts verified cyber financial fraud complaints exceeding ₹10 lakh — filed on cybercrime.gov.in or via the 1930 helpline — into actionable Zero FIRs routed instantly to the territorially competent cyber police station, bypassing the jurisdictional friction that has historically stalled cross-state cyber crime investigations. Assam went live on June 23, a day before the PRAGATI meeting, making it the first state to deploy the system.

The directive comes amid mounting losses from “digital arrest” scams — where fraudsters impersonate law enforcement agencies via video calls, confine victims digitally, and extort money. The PRAGATI meeting reviewed four major infrastructure projects worth approximately ₹30,000 crore alongside the TB Mukt Bharat Abhiyan, but it was the e-Zero FIR mandate that signals a fundamental shift: cyber fraud complaints are now treated as interstate crimes by default, not exceptions requiring manual coordination.

Consumer angle: The system directly addresses the jurisdiction shopping that police stations have historically engaged in — “that happened in another state, file there” — which has been the single biggest barrier to cyber fraud recovery for ordinary citizens.


2. DPDP Act Enforcement Tightens: AI Research Tools Face New Liability Framework

The Digital Personal Data Protection (DPDP) Act, 2023 continued its slow but decisive operationalisation through July-August 2026, with the July 2026 DPDP Intelligence Briefing from DPDPIndia.in flagging critical new liability vectors for legal professionals and AI tool vendors.

The briefing highlighted that advocates and law firms using AI research or drafting tools must now institute internal verification protocols, as the disclosure duty under the DPDP framework — combined with non-delegable accuracy liability — makes “the tool got it wrong” a career risk, not a defence. Legal-tech vendors targeting courts must design for explainability and sandbox testing from day one.

5. The Bhashini Paradox: AI Accessibility Meets Data Sovereignty

Bhashini, India’s AI language translation platform, had a significant week. The platform powers the newly launched “Samadhan Didi” AI chatbot on CPGRAMS — enabling citizens to file grievances by voice in any of India’s 22 scheduled languages. The chatbot, launched on May 30, 2026, uses AI to identify the appropriate ministry and grievance category, routing complaints to the correct Grievance Redressal Officer automatically.

Bhashini was also integrated into the National Cooperative Database (NCD) portal 3.0, launched by the Home & Cooperation Minister on July 6, 2026, providing multilingual support through Bhashini integration — alongside features like OTP-based secure login, village-level GIS mapping, and an AI chatbot.

But Bhashini’s expanded deployment across government platforms raises a critical L7 question: where does the voice data go? When a citizen speaks their grievance in Odia or Tamil to Samadhan Didi, that voice data is processed, transcribed, translated, and routed — creating a chain of data processing that must comply with DPDP’s consent and purpose-limitation requirements. The government has not publicly disclosed Bhashini’s data retention policies, processing locations, or whether third-party AI vendors are involved in the transcription pipeline.

This is the Bhashini paradox: the same AI tool that makes governance accessible to 1.4 billion citizens in their own languages also creates one of the largest voice data repositories in Indian government history.
